Q: Is 241,116,508 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 241,116,508 is a composite number.

Why is 241,116,508 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 241,116,508 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 17 34 68 3,545,831 7,091,662 14,183,324 60,279,127 120,558,254 and 241,116,508, with no remainder.

Since 241,116,508 cannot be divided by just 1 and 241,116,508, it is a composite number.
